第五章 搭建S36510开发板的测试环境
第五章 搭建S36510开发板的测试环境
本章学习了如何在开发板上去安装android,OK-6410-A是一款不需要去编译的开发板,这里讲述了S36510开发板的编译,开发板是开发和学习嵌入式技术的主要硬件设备。
S3C6410开发板的简介:S3C6410开发板是三星公司推出的一款高性价比,低功耗的RISC的处理器,提供了优化的硬件性能那只强大的硬件加速器,还集成了FMC。
S3C6410是一款低功耗、高性价比的RSIC处理器,可广泛应用于移动电话和通用处理等领域
S3C6410为2.5G和3G通信服务提供了优化的硬件性能,内置强大的硬件加速器:包括运动视频处理、音频处理、2D加速、显示处理和缩放等。
S3C6410集成了一个MFC(Multi-Format video Codec)支持MPEG4 / H.263 / H.264编解码和VC1的解码,能够提供实时的视频会议以及NTSC和PAL制式的CVBS输出。
S3C6410处理器内置一个采用先进技术的3D加速器,支持OpenGL ES 1.1 / 2.0和D3DM API,能实现4Mtriangles/s的3D加速。
S3C6410包含了优化的外部存储器接口,该接口能满足在高端通信服务中的数据带宽要求。
安装串口调试工具(mincom):1.检测当前系统是否支持USB转串口
lsmod | grep usbserial
2.安装minicom
apt-get install minicom
3.配置minicom
minicom –s
4.测试minicom
minicom
烧写Android系统:在烧写Android系统之前必须启动Eboot去擦除NandFlash,擦除方法如下:1.准备工作;2.进入Eboot状态;3.擦除NandFlash。接下就是烧写Android的步骤了:(1)将Sd卡按照FAT32分区格式,连接PC
(2)向SD卡中写入mmc.bin和zImage-sd.bin
(3)将SW2的引脚Pin4、5、6、7、8向右拨动为On。为SD卡启动
(4)开始从SD卡烧写Android
输入.yjsx命令,复制SD卡中的数据,出现“great!!! All jobs over”说明成功
(5)校准屏幕
关闭开发板,将开关恢复到NandFlash启动状态,重启开发板进行校准。
可以输入rm /data/pointercal删除屏幕校准文件,重新校准。
配置有线网络:配置有线网络:配置开发板和手机的方式一样,大多数的开发板都会有一个以太网口可以供网线和外部设备连接。大那是并不是直接使用网线把开发板和路由或Hub连接开发板就能连接进网络,很多开发板自带的Android系统不能自动分配IP地址,所以我们必须手工进行设置开发板的IP地址,子网掩码和网关,这样才能连接上网络。
Ifconfig eth0 192.168.17.150 netmask 255.255.255.0 up
Route add default gw 192.168.17.254 dev eth0
查看当前Ip配置和路由表:
/system/busybox/sbin/ifconfig
/system/busybox/sbin/route
很多开发板自带的Android系统不能自动分配IP地址,所以我们必须手工进行设置开发板的IP地址,子网掩码和网关,这样才能连接上网络。